WebRequestEvent Class

Definition

Defines the base class for events providing Web-request information.

C#
public class WebRequestEvent : System.Web.Management.WebManagementEvent

Examples

The following code example shows how to derive from the WebRequestEvent class to create a custom event.

C#

using System;
using System.Text;
using System.Web;
using System.Web.Management;
using System.Web.UI;
using System.Web.UI.WebControls;

namespace SamplesAspNet
{
    // Implements a custom WebRequestEvent. 
    public class SampleWebRequestEvent :
      System.Web.Management.WebRequestEvent
    {
        private string  customCreatedMsg, 
                        customRaisedMsg;

        // Invoked in case of events identified only 
        // by their event code.
        public SampleWebRequestEvent(
            string msg, 
            object eventSource, int eventCode): 
            base(msg, eventSource, eventCode)
        {
           
            // Perform custom initialization.
            customCreatedMsg =
              string.Format(
              "Event created at: {0}", 
              EventTime.ToString());
        }

        // Invoked in case of events identified 
        // by their event code.and 
        // related event detailed code.
        public SampleWebRequestEvent(string msg,
            object eventSource, int eventCode,
            int eventDetailCode):
            base(msg, eventSource, eventCode, 
            eventDetailCode)
        {
            // Perform custom initialization.
            customCreatedMsg =
              string.Format(
              "Event created at: {0}", 
              EventTime.ToString());
        }


        // Raises the SampleWebRequestEvent.
        public override void Raise()
        {
            // Perform custom processing.
            customRaisedMsg =
              string.Format(
              "Event raised at: {0}", 
              EventTime.ToString());

            // Raise the event.
            base.Raise();
        }

        //Formats Web request event information.
        public override void FormatCustomEventDetails(
            WebEventFormatter formatter)
        {
            // Add custom data.
            formatter.AppendLine("");

            formatter.IndentationLevel += 1;
            formatter.AppendLine(
                "* Custom Request Information Start *");

            //// Display custom event timing.
            formatter.AppendLine(customCreatedMsg);
            formatter.AppendLine(customRaisedMsg);

            formatter.AppendLine(
                "* Custom Request Information End *");

            formatter.IndentationLevel -= 1;
        }

    }
}

The following is an excerpt of the configuration file that enables ASP.NET to use the custom event.

<healthMonitoring   
  enabled="true" heartBeatInterval="0">  
  <providers>  
    <!-- Define the custom provider that   
         processes custom Web request events. -->  
    <add name="SampleWebEventProvider"   
type="SamplesAspNet.SampleEventProvider,webeventprovider,Version=1.0.1573.18094, Culture=neutral, PublicKeyToken=b5a57a9a9d487cf4, processorArchitecture=MSIL"/>  
  </providers>  

  <eventMappings>  
    <!--  Define the event source that   
         issues custom events.   -->  
    <add  name="SampleWebRequestEvent"   
type="SamplesAspNet.SampleWebRequestEvent,webrequestevent,Version=1.0.1573.23947, Culture=neutral, PublicKeyToken=e717d983a78c8ddb, processorArchitecture=MSIL"/>  
    </eventMappings>  

  <rules>  
        <!-- Associate custom event with   
        related custom provider -->  
    <add   
      name="CustomWebRequestEvent"  
      eventName="SampleWebRequestEvent"   
      provider="SampleWebEventProvider"   
      profile="Critical"/>  
  </rules>  
</healthMonitoring>  

Remarks

The WebRequestEvent is raised at every Web request.

It uses the WebRequestInformation class to obtain request information.

In most cases you will use the standard ASP.NET health-monitoring types and control their behavior by setting the healthMonitoring configuration section. You can also create custom types, as shown in the next example. If you create your custom event type and you need to add your own information, customize the FormatCustomEventDetails method. This will avoid overwriting or tampering with sensitive system information.
